This is only an idea but... You say vtec doesn't "pop" like it used to. Have you checked your oil level? If you get about two quarts low you won't have the oil pressure for vtec to engage the high cam.

JDM ITR's went on sale in late 95, which in Japan makes them a 1995 ITR. They don't go by model years, but by date of sale. 95's are "96 spec" but they are still 95s.
